FurnishWEB Moves to New Server
March 01, 2010 · No Comments
FurnishWEB has been successfully moved to a bigger, faster server with the latest server software upgrades. The move took a lot of planning & testing. Over the weekend, we shut down FurnishWEB from 8:00 PM Friday EDT to around 12:00 Noon Sunday EDT while copying & testing all the programs & data. After a couple of hiccups, we brought the new server online for full system testing on Saturday which went very well. So we cut over to the new server late Sunday morning.

Smart Sales ... a higher level of sales analysis.
January 01, 2010 · No Comments
Now, with Smart Sales, we have data accumulated and reportable for entire territories. This allows a sales rep or sales manager to compare year-over-year data for a territory ... product, dealer, and collection data aggregated, totaled, and sortable quickly and easily. There's even a series of PDF reports to snap shot the data for printable review.
